IDC – Smartphone Production Declines 14.6% In Q1 2023


 The smartphone industry has not yet recovered from the impact of the pandemic in Q1 2023. According to the latest IDC report, smartphone production fell 14.6% last quarter compared to the same quarter of 2022. A total of 268.6 million phones were produced during this period compared to 314.5 million in the same quarter last year.



Samsung still holds the largest market with 22.5% followed by Apple (20.5%), Xiaomi (11.4%), Oppo (10.2%) and Vivo (7.6%). Xiaomi was the worst affected with a reduction of 23.5% followed by Samsung with 18.9%. Apple was least affected as the reduction was only 2.3%. The phone market is expected to continue to decline this year due to economic factors as well as rising device prices.
